[]
sql ne yahu?
derse bir hafta gitmedim, uzaydan gelmişe döndüm. sql'i anlatmış hoca. slaytlarda sadece komutlar var da ben bu komutları nerde kullanacağım? access'te mi? gerildim.
boşver kalacaksın zaten, hiç kasma bu saatten sonra.
- bigbadabum (21.05.15 01:10:05)
şimdi sen bunu yazdığında aklıma uni'de hocaya sql ne websitelerinde felanmı kullanılıyor deyip soruma hiçbir cevap vermediği günler geldi. hayat bazen okulda zorlaşıyor. halbuki sevsen(sevdiğii söyleyebilirsin) isteyerek uğraşsan ayrıntı teknolojiler olduğunu görürsün.
- 2006 (21.05.15 01:18:26)
Veri sorgulama dili. 1 haftada ogrenilecek kadarini ogrettiyse daha bir sey yok, ama bilen birininden ogrenmen lazim, veya internette tonla kaynak var onlara bak.
- compumaster (21.05.15 01:18:33)
telaşlanmana gerek yok sql server kur bilgisayarına 1 haftada anca tabloları ve select sorguları fln göstermiştir, aynen internette tonla kaynak var (git: www.verivizyon.com
- k (21.05.15 01:48:01 ~ 01:51:13)
Matematikte iyiysen (ilk okul, ortaokul matematiği) ve kümeleri hatırlıyorsan eğer SQL dediğin şey çok kolay bir şey. 2 ana komut ile küme oluştursun 4 komut ile de bu kümeler içinde işlem yaparsın.
Küme oluşturma için CREATE TABLE küme_adi (nitelik nitelik_türü); Biz SQL'den bahsederken küme demeyiz de tablo deriz ama matematiksel karşılığı küme'dir.
Kümeyi oluştururken küme içerisindeki veriye göre bir takım nitelikler olması gerekir, niteliklerin bir kısmı sana daha önceden verilir, bir kısmını da sen bulursun örneğin tavuklara ait bir küme oluştur dendiği zaman,
Bunlar sana verildi;
1) tavukların follukları vardır,
2) cinsiyetleri vardır (Horoz veya tavuk)
3) cinsleri vardır, (denizli, paçalı vs.)
Sende bunu ekledin yukarıdakilere;
4) yumurtadan çıkış günleri vardır (vs. vs. vs.)
create table tavuklar_kumesi (folluk_no integer, cinsiyeti string, cinsi string,
dogum_gunu date);
Kümeyi silmek için ise DROP TABLE küme_adı;
Küme işlemleri yapmak için ise;
1) INSERT, veri kümesine yeni veri ekler, örn: insert into tavuk_kumesi (folluk_no, tavuk_adi, cinsi) values (1, "çilli", "tavuk");
2) UPDATE veri kümesindeki veriyi günceller, örn: update tavuk_kumesi SET cinsi="horoz"
3) DELETE, veri kümesindeki verisi siler örn: DELETE FROM tavuk_kumesi
4) SELECT, veri kümesindeki belirli kriterlere göre veriyi getirir.
küme konularından hatırlarsın, büyük bir küme vardır içinde meyveler vardır, sana bu kümeyi çeşitli kriterlere göre alt kümelere ayır, misalen sarı renkli meyveler kümesi oluştur falan derler, sende hemen o büyük kümeden armut, kayısı ve kavunu daire içine alır ve yeni bir alt küme oluşturursun. Bunu SQL'de yapmak için WHERE kullanılıyor, WHERE cinsi="tavuk" Bir kümedeki elemanlardan bir takım kriterlere göre alt kümelere oluşturarak bu yeni oluşturduğun alt küme içerisinde işlem yaparsın. bu işlem insert hariç hepsi olabilir, yani UPDATE, DELETE, ve SELECT
birde kümeleri birleştirmek var, iki farklı kümeyi bir büyük küme haline getirmek örneğin arabalar ve motosikletleri birleştirerek daha büyük olan motorlu taşıtlar kümesi oluşturmak gibi, Bunun içinde JOIN var.
Küme konusunu ne kadar iyi hatırlarsan veri tabanını da o kadar iyi tasarlarsın.
Hadi kolay gelsin, biraz küme konularını çalış küme işlemlerinde kullanılan işaretleri falan hatırla.
Birde Mysql olur, PostgreSQL olur, SQlite olur, mariaDB olur, vs. vs. vs. illaki access olacak diye bişi yok yani, bence sen SQLite yada MySQL kullan sen.
Küme oluşturma için CREATE TABLE küme_adi (nitelik nitelik_türü); Biz SQL'den bahsederken küme demeyiz de tablo deriz ama matematiksel karşılığı küme'dir.
Kümeyi oluştururken küme içerisindeki veriye göre bir takım nitelikler olması gerekir, niteliklerin bir kısmı sana daha önceden verilir, bir kısmını da sen bulursun örneğin tavuklara ait bir küme oluştur dendiği zaman,
Bunlar sana verildi;
1) tavukların follukları vardır,
2) cinsiyetleri vardır (Horoz veya tavuk)
3) cinsleri vardır, (denizli, paçalı vs.)
Sende bunu ekledin yukarıdakilere;
4) yumurtadan çıkış günleri vardır (vs. vs. vs.)
create table tavuklar_kumesi (folluk_no integer, cinsiyeti string, cinsi string,
dogum_gunu date);
Kümeyi silmek için ise DROP TABLE küme_adı;
Küme işlemleri yapmak için ise;
1) INSERT, veri kümesine yeni veri ekler, örn: insert into tavuk_kumesi (folluk_no, tavuk_adi, cinsi) values (1, "çilli", "tavuk");
2) UPDATE veri kümesindeki veriyi günceller, örn: update tavuk_kumesi SET cinsi="horoz"
3) DELETE, veri kümesindeki verisi siler örn: DELETE FROM tavuk_kumesi
4) SELECT, veri kümesindeki belirli kriterlere göre veriyi getirir.
küme konularından hatırlarsın, büyük bir küme vardır içinde meyveler vardır, sana bu kümeyi çeşitli kriterlere göre alt kümelere ayır, misalen sarı renkli meyveler kümesi oluştur falan derler, sende hemen o büyük kümeden armut, kayısı ve kavunu daire içine alır ve yeni bir alt küme oluşturursun. Bunu SQL'de yapmak için WHERE kullanılıyor, WHERE cinsi="tavuk" Bir kümedeki elemanlardan bir takım kriterlere göre alt kümelere oluşturarak bu yeni oluşturduğun alt küme içerisinde işlem yaparsın. bu işlem insert hariç hepsi olabilir, yani UPDATE, DELETE, ve SELECT
birde kümeleri birleştirmek var, iki farklı kümeyi bir büyük küme haline getirmek örneğin arabalar ve motosikletleri birleştirerek daha büyük olan motorlu taşıtlar kümesi oluşturmak gibi, Bunun içinde JOIN var.
Küme konusunu ne kadar iyi hatırlarsan veri tabanını da o kadar iyi tasarlarsın.
Hadi kolay gelsin, biraz küme konularını çalış küme işlemlerinde kullanılan işaretleri falan hatırla.
Birde Mysql olur, PostgreSQL olur, SQlite olur, mariaDB olur, vs. vs. vs. illaki access olacak diye bişi yok yani, bence sen SQLite yada MySQL kullan sen.
- selam (21.05.15 02:37:56 ~ 02:54:04)
sql, aşktır
- probiyotik (21.05.15 02:55:52)
1